Background
An injection mold is a tool for producing plastic products and also a tool for giving the plastic products complete structure and precise dimensions. Injection molding is a processing method used for mass production of parts with complex shapes, and particularly relates to a method for obtaining a formed product by taking molten plastic into a mold cavity at high pressure through an injection molding machine, cooling and solidifying and ejecting.
The plastic part product ejection mechanism is a system device for safely and nondestructively ejecting an injection molding part out of a mold cavity. At present, after an injection product with a common shape is molded, the product can be separated from a mold only by singly ejecting a conventional ejector sleeve, an ejector pin and the like for demolding, but along with the diversification of the injection product, for some products with complex shapes, especially high-precision thin-wall plastic products, the problems that full-automatic production cannot be realized or the size precision of the plastic products cannot be ensured by one-time ejection often exist, and the like, and secondary ejection is often needed. However, most of the existing secondary ejection mechanisms are complex in structure, and a plurality of accessory parts are usually required to be added on the basis of a standard die structure, so that not only is the die cost increased, but also the existing secondary ejection mechanisms are inconvenient to use in many occasions due to the limitation of the size and the structure of a product.

Detailed Description

As shown in fig. 1 and 2, a secondary ejection mechanism of a high-precision thin-wall plastic injection mold comprises a front mold panel 17, a front mold plate 1, a push plate 2, a rear mold plate 3, an ejector plate 4 and a bottom plate 5, wherein the front mold panel 17 is installed on one side of the front mold plate 1, a front mold core 6 is arranged inside the front mold plate 1, the push plate 2 is arranged between the front mold plate 1 and the rear mold plate 3, a rear mold core 7 is arranged inside the push plate 2, the lower end of the rear mold plate 3 is connected with the bottom plate 5, the middle of the bottom plate 5 is of a groove structure, the ejector plate 4 is arranged in a groove 8, an ejector 9 penetrates through the bottom plate 5 to be connected with an ejection system of an injection molding machine, an ejector pin 10 and a return pin 11 are arranged on the ejector plate 4, the top end of the ejector pin 10 slidably penetrates through the rear mold plate 3 and the rear mold core 7 inside the push plate 2, the return pin 11 penetrates through the rear mold plate 3 to be connected with the push, and the rear template 3 is also respectively provided with a contour screw 13 for limiting the push plate 2 and an air cylinder 14 for pushing the push plate 2 to move.
Further, the front mould panel 17 is fixedly connected with the front mould plate 1 through threads.
Further, the backstitch 11 is fixedly connected with the backstitch pulling block 12 through threads.
Further, the rear template 3 is connected with the bottom plate 5 through threads.
Furthermore, the ejector plate 4 is connected with an ejection system of the injection molding machine through internal threads of an ejector rod 9.
Further, the equal-height screws 13 are fixedly connected with the rear template 3 through threads.
Furthermore, the rear template 3 is also provided with an insert pin 15 for forming an inner cavity on a plastic product 16.
The working principle of the utility model is as follows:
in the process of opening the die, the push plate 2 and the ejector plate 4 are connected with the ejector rod 9 by using the return pin 11 and the return pin pull block 12, and the die opening between the front template 1 and the push plate 2 is realized firstly; at the moment, an ejection system of the injection molding machine is started, the ejector rod 9 pushes the ejector plate 4, and the air cylinder 14 pushes the push plate 2, so that the push plate 2 and the ejector pin 10 move simultaneously to finish primary ejection; when the push plate 2 reaches the limit distance of the equal-height screw 13, the push plate 2 stops moving under the limit of the equal-height screw 13, the ejector rod 9 pushes the ejector plate 4 to continue moving, the ejector pin 10 continues ejecting, the secondary ejection effect is realized, and the plastic part 16 automatically falls into the product collection frame; when the die is closed, the injection molding machine pulls the ejector plate 4 through the ejector rod 9, so that the ejector plate 2 and the ejector pin 10 are reset.
The utility model discloses secondary ejection mechanism ejecting distance is adjustable, and the cylinder is ejecting stable safety and device rational in infrastructure, the action is reliable and stable.
